King's Day Description
King's Day celebrates the birthday of King Willem-Alexander and is the Netherlands' most vibrant national holiday. The entire country transforms into a sea of orange, with street markets ("vrijmarkt") where anyone may sell goods without a permit, especially in Amsterdam and Utrecht. Canals fill with decorated boats, open-air concerts ring out, and children's games animate every neighborhood. Public offices, banks, and most businesses close, though bars and restaurants operate at full capacity. The preceding night, King's Night, features club events and festivals.
